Isabel Manns’s collection was the first event I went to and it was stunning. The collection was an aray of the most beautiful colours, patterns and materials. Every item was timeless, ageless and seasonless. The material was the most luxurious silk which hung in the most flattering way on everyone wearing the label. I would have bought every piece if I had the money but for now I will just have to dream. Maybe I’ll treat myself to a piece for my birthday.
Isabel Manns is all about sustainability which I love. Most items are reversible so you’re getting two outfits in one and without the guilt of the horrible impact that fast fashion has on the environment. Isabel’s label is the very definition of a capsule wardrobe, pieces suitable for all seasons, ages and will stand the test of time. I cannot compliment the collection enough. If that wasn’t good enough, they also donate some profits to a chosen charity each year.
